What is Text-to-Pay and How Does It Work?

Text-to-pay is a payment solution enabling customers to make purchases via text messages. After checkout or service, customers receive a text link that allows them to complete the payment seamlessly from their mobile devices. This system enhances the transaction process by catering to the growing demand for mobile payment solutions in retail.

What are the Costs Involved in Setting Up Text-to-Pay?

Setting up a text-to-pay system incurs several costs. Generally, you should expect:

Setup Fees

Many providers charge a one-time setup fee averaging $500, covering initial installation and configuration.

Transaction Fees

Expect rates around 1.5% to 3% per transaction, depending on your payment processor, which can impact overall profitability.

Monthly Fees

Some vendors may charge a monthly service fee ranging from $20 to $50, which should be factored into your budgeting.
